Understanding the multi-stage insulation physics that guarantees maximum thermal barrier performance in high-ambient temperature regions like Daloa.
Our flasks feature a 0.7mm high-vacuum chamber evacuated to 10-4 Pa pressure during automated vacuum-furnace annealing. This eliminates molecular heat transfer via conduction and convection, keeping beverages icy cold even in Daloa's afternoon sun.
The exterior of the inner 304 stainless steel wall is electroplated with a micro-thin thermal reflection copper coating. This layer reflects infrared heat radiation back into the liquid, boosting heat retention by over 15% compared to standard vacuum bottles.
Finished with electrostatic polymer powder coating cured at 200°C. Provides anti-scratch protection, non-slip sweat-free tactile grip, and superior resistance to chemical degradation caused by sweat and environmental moisture.
| Test Metric | Initial Temp | 4 Hours | 8 Hours | 12 Hours | 24 Hours |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Cold Retention Test (Ice Water) | 2°C | 3.1°C | 4.5°C | 6.2°C | 8.9°C |
| Hot Retention Test (Boiling Water) | 98°C | 88°C | 79°C | 71°C | 58°C |
| Structural Integrity Drop Test | Passes 1.5-meter concrete drop impact standard without loss of vacuum isolation. | ||||
| Sealing Gasket Life Cycle | Tested for 50,000 lid-thread open/close cycles (Food-Grade Silicone + BPA-Free PP). | ||||
